ABSTRACT. Chromosomes of Baryscapus silvestrii Viggiani et Bernardo, 2007 (Eulophidae) with n = 6 and 2n = 12 were studied using base-specific fluorochrome staining. Chromomycin A3 / 4', 6-diamidino-2-phenylindole (CMA3/DAPI) staining revealed a single paired CMA3-positive band within the diploid karyotype of B. silvestrii. This CG-rich segment apparently corresponds to the nucleolus organizing region (NOR). Certain features of karyotype evolution of parasitoids of the family Eulophidae are discussed.
